What is Shiba Inu Coin?

Shiba Inu Coin (SHIB) is a decentralized cryptocurrency created in August 2020 by an anonymous individual or group known as "Ryoshi." It is named after the Japanese breed of dog, the Shiba Inu, and is often associated with Dogecoin (DOGE).

SHIB operates on the Ethereum blockchain and is designed to be a decentralized, community-driven cryptocurrency. It has gained popularity due to its association with Dogecoin, which has inspired a wave of meme-inspired cryptocurrencies.

Popularity and Growth

Shiba Inu Coin experienced a significant surge in popularity in 2021, fueled by social media hype and support from prominent individuals such as Elon Musk. This led to a sharp increase in its value, making it one of the most popular cryptocurrencies in the market.

Utility and Use Cases

Shiba Inu Coin has limited use cases beyond being a speculative asset. However, its developers have launched a decentralized exchange called "Shibaswap" and a non-fungible token (NFT) platform called "ShibaSwap NFTs."
